Navigate to Security Settings

You'll find your Spectrum security code by navigating to the security settings section of your account. This area is vital for safeguarding your data and preventing unauthorized access. Here's how to proceed:

  1. Log into Your Spectrum Account: Ensure you're on the official Spectrum website for security.
  2. Access the Menu: Look for an option labeled ‘Settings' or similar.
  3. Select ‘Security Settings': This section houses the controls for your security code and other safety features.
  4. Locate the Security Code Section: Your unique security code should be visible here, or you might need to set it up if it's your first time.

Always choose a security code that's unique and complex for enhanced security.

Resetting Your Security Code

To reset your Spectrum security code, first log into your account online and head to the Security Settings section.

Here's a straightforward guide to update your security code:

  1. Log In: Access your online account using your username and password.
  2. Navigate to Security Settings: Find the option to reset your Spectrum security code.
  3. Verify Your Identity: Complete any required steps to confirm your identity. This may include answering security questions or receiving a verification code.
  4. Create New Code: Set up a new security code. Make sure it's unique and complex to keep your account access secure.
